Codesandbox MCP
CodeSandbox MCPサーバーは、CodeSandbox SDK操作をツールとして公開し、AIエージェントがサンドボックスの作成、ファイルの読み書きなどの操作を行えるようにします。
スコア : 2.5ポイント
ダウンロード数 : 6.6K
CodeSandbox MCP Serverとは?
CodeSandbox MCP Serverは、AIアシスタントとクラウド開発環境をつなぐ架け橋です。ClaudeやCursorなどのAIツールが、CodeSandbox内の開発サンドボックスを直接作成、管理、操作できるようにし、コード編集、ファイル管理、環境構成などの操作を人手を介さずに行えるようにします。CodeSandbox MCP Serverをどのように使用するか?
MCPクライアント(Claude DesktopやCursorなど)を構成し、このサーバーをツールプロバイダーとして設定します。AIアシスタントが承認を得ると、さまざまなツールを呼び出してCodeSandboxサンドボックスを操作できます。これには、新しいプロジェクトの作成、ファイルの読み書き、仮想マシンの管理などが含まれます。適用シナリオ
AI支援プログラミング、自動コード生成、クラウド開発環境管理、チーム協業コードレビュー、教育用プログラミングデモなどのシナリオに適しています。特に、迅速なプロトタイプ開発とリモート協業が必要なプロジェクトに最適です。主要機能
サンドボックスの全ライフサイクル管理
サンドボックスの作成、起動、休眠、更新、および情報取得を行い、テンプレートからの迅速なプロジェクト作成をサポートします。
ファイルシステム操作
ファイルの読み書き、ディレクトリ内容の一覧表示、ファイルの名前変更と移動を行い、UTF - 8およびBase64エンコーディングをサポートします。
セッション管理
開発セッションの作成と復元を行い、読み書き権限の制御と環境変数の構成をサポートします。
仮想マシン制御
サンドボックス仮想マシンのリソースレベル(PicoからXLarge)、休眠タイムアウト、および自動起動構成を制御します。
ステートレス設計
各呼び出しは独立して実行され、サーバー側の状態を保持しません。これにより、操作の安全性と再現性が確保されます。
読み取り専用モードのサポート
読み取り専用モードに構成でき、誤った変更を防止します。セキュリティに敏感な環境に適しています。
利点
AIアシスタントとクラウド開発環境のシームレスな統合
完全なファイル操作とプロジェクト管理のサポート
柔軟な仮想マシンリソース構成
ステートレス設計による操作の安全性の確保
テンプレートからの迅速なプロジェクト作成のサポート
構成可能な権限制御(読み書き/読み取り専用)
制限
CodeSandbox APIトークンの承認が必要です。
新版のCodeSandboxサンドボックス(VM)のみをサポートし、旧版のプロジェクトはサポートしません。
ファイル操作ごとに接続を確立する必要があります。
ネットワーク遅延が操作の応答速度に影響を与える可能性があります。
Node.js 18+の実行環境が必要です。
使い方
APIトークンを取得する
CodeSandboxアカウント設定で個人用アクセストークンを作成します。サンドボックスの作成、読み書き編集、仮想マシン管理、およびプレビュートークン管理の権限を含める必要があります。
MCPクライアントを構成する
Claude DesktopやCursorなどのMCP対応クライアントで、このサーバーをmcp.json構成ファイルに追加します。
サーバーを起動する
クライアントが自動的にサーバーを起動するか、コマンドラインで手動で起動してテストできます。
AIアシスタントを通じて使用する
対応するAIアシスタントのインターフェイスで、CodeSandbox関連のツールを使用して開発環境を管理できます。
使用例
Reactアプリケーションのプロトタイプを迅速に作成する
AIアシスタントがユーザーの要求に基づいてReactアプリケーションのサンドボックスを迅速に作成し、必要なコンポーネントと構成を追加します。
プロジェクトファイルを一括で変更する
AIアシスタントが既存のプロジェクト内の構成ファイルまたはコードファイルを一括で更新します。
環境構成管理
異なる用途のサンドボックスに異なる仮想マシンリソースと環境変数を構成します。
チームコードレビューの支援
AIアシスタントがチームメンバーのサンドボックスにアクセスし、コードレビューと提案を行います。
よくある質問
どのようなCodeSandboxアカウント権限が必要ですか?
このサーバーは私のコードやデータを保存しますか?
どのMCPクライアントがサポートされていますか?
仮想マシンの休眠とは何を意味しますか?
操作の安全性をどのように確保しますか?
操作に遅延はありますか?
チーム協業はサポートされていますか?
問題のデバッグ方法は?
関連リソース
CodeSandbox公式ドキュメント
CodeSandboxプラットフォームの完全なドキュメントとAPIリファレンス
Model Context Protocol仕様
MCPプロトコルの公式仕様と実装ガイド
GitHubリポジトリ
プロジェクトのソースコードと問題追跡
npmパッケージページ
最新バージョンとインストール統計
Claude Desktop構成ガイド
Claude DesktopでMCPサーバーを使用する方法を構成する方法
CodeSandbox APIリファレンス
完全なCodeSandbox REST APIドキュメント

Edgeone Pages MCP Server
EdgeOne Pages MCPは、MCPプロトコルを通じてHTMLコンテンツをEdgeOne Pagesに迅速にデプロイし、公開URLを取得するサービスです。
TypeScript
21.5K
4.8ポイント

Context7
Context7 MCPは、AIプログラミングアシスタントにリアルタイムのバージョン固有のドキュメントとコード例を提供するサービスで、Model Context Protocolを通じてプロンプトに直接統合され、LLMが古い情報を使用する問題を解決します。
TypeScript
68.8K
4.7ポイント

Gmail MCP Server
Claude Desktop用に設計されたGmail自動認証MCPサーバーで、自然言語でのやり取りによるGmailの管理をサポートし、メール送信、ラベル管理、一括操作などの完全な機能を備えています。
TypeScript
15.9K
4.5ポイント

Baidu Map
認証済み
百度マップMCPサーバーは国内初のMCPプロトコルに対応した地図サービスで、地理コーディング、ルート計画など10個の標準化されたAPIインターフェースを提供し、PythonとTypescriptでの迅速な接続をサポートし、エージェントに地図関連の機能を実現させます。
Python
33.7K
4.5ポイント

Gitlab MCP Server
認証済み
GitLab MCPサーバーは、Model Context Protocolに基づくプロジェクトで、GitLabアカウントとのやり取りに必要な包括的なツールセットを提供します。コードレビュー、マージリクエスト管理、CI/CD設定などの機能が含まれます。
TypeScript
17.9K
4.3ポイント

Unity
認証済み
UnityMCPはUnityエディターのプラグインで、モデルコンテキストプロトコル (MCP) を実装し、UnityとAIアシスタントのシームレスな統合を提供します。リアルタイムの状態監視、リモートコマンドの実行、ログ機能が含まれます。
C#
24.3K
5ポイント

Magic MCP
Magic Component Platform (MCP) はAI駆動のUIコンポーネント生成ツールで、自然言語での記述を通じて、開発者が迅速に現代的なUIコンポーネントを作成するのを支援し、複数のIDEとの統合をサポートします。
JavaScript
18.7K
5ポイント

Sequential Thinking MCP Server
MCPプロトコルに基づく構造化思考サーバーで、思考段階を定義することで複雑な問題を分解し要約を生成するのに役立ちます。
Python
28.7K
4.5ポイント

